Profile for Ted Hankey
Country: England
Lives in: Telford, Shropshire
Date of birth: Tue, Feb 20th, 1968
Nickname: The Count
Professional Darts Player
Lakeside debut: 1998
Lakeside best: World Champion 2000 and 2009
The 2000 and 2009 Lakeside World Professional Darts Champion and 2009 England Open Champion, he was runner-up in the 2009 BDO International Open. He won the 2000 World Pro with an unforgettable 170 checkout and a record-breaking 48 maximums in just 46 minutes! Just 12 months ago he recorded 42 maximums and took a little longer – 133 minutes to be precise! He was 2008 IDPA Lakeside Classic Champion and 2007 BDO England Open Champion. He was also runner-up in the 2001 Lakeside World Championship. A Semi-Finalist in both the 2004 Winmau World Masters and 2005 Denmark Open, he was 2004 Norway Open Champion and runner-up in the 2004 BDO England Open. He won four major titles in 2003: The Dutch Open (he also won it in 2002), German Open, BDO England Open and the Denmark Open. This is his 12th Lakeside appearance and his love of the Dracula legend has made him a huge crowd favourite. He and his wife Sarah have a daughter, Leah and two sons, Matthew and Edward.
